On August 16, 2005, a Colombia passenger plane crashed in Venezuela, killing 160 people
On August 16, 2005 (July 12, 2005 in the lunar calendar), a Colombia passenger plane crashed in Venezuela, killing 160 people. 152 residents of the French island of Martinique returned home on a flight of Colombia Western Caribbean Airlines after a long week of vacation in Panama. However, they never expected that what awaited them after the happy holiday would be a human tragedy. The passenger plane crashed in western Venezuela in the early morning of the 16th local time, killing all 152 passengers and 8 crew members.
